So what we have done is to really cut back on everything...shop around for better deals on your home/auto insurance, cell phones, put on warmer clothes and turn down the heater, buy generic foods, etc. Try to go thru the garage to sell items you truly don't use/need anymore. Also, if you have gold jewlery you don't like or is broken, missing it's mate, etc, you can sell it and make some serious cash.
